Melk Benedictine Abbey Stift Monastery Wachau Valley Lower Austria The Melk Benedictine Abbey, also known as the Melk Abbey, is one of the most famous Abbeys in the world. The Abbey is situated in the Wachau Valley in Lower Austria; a region of striking landscapes which has been designated a World Heritage Site. |
Stift Melk Austria Founded in 1089, Stift Melk is a Benedictine monastery situated in Austria, Europe. |
